Thohoyandou, Gauteng, South Af...
Thohoyandou Giyani Mokopane Th...
Thohoyandou Giyani Mokopane Th...
Thohoyandou, Gauteng, South Af...
THOHOYANDOU, LIMPOPO, South Af...
Thohoyandou Giyani Mokopane Th...
India, India, India.
India, India, India.
polokwane, Limpopo, South Afri...
India, India, India.
Bell Island, Newfoundland, Aus...
Morgenzon, Gauteng, South Afri...